Couleur violette du lien à changer
amalthee
-
Utilisateur anonyme -
Utilisateur anonyme -
Bonjour, pour essayer de faire clair, je travaille en mode html sur un nouveau site. Et j'ai pu mettre des liens avec la balise <a href... Quand je cliques sur le résultat, cela marche sauf que d'un point de vue esthétique, il y a une sorte de carré violet qui s'inscrit. Par exemple en lien "chapitre.html" est en violet. Ou bien j'avais créé un bouton intéractif sur mon pc pour servir de lien aux différentes pages, et en le mettant en lien, c'est encadré par un cadre violet. J'aimerai savoir s'il est possible de changer la couleur du lien html. Merci et bonne soirée
A voir également:
- Couleur violette du lien à changer
- Changer dns - Guide
- Lien url - Guide
- Créer un lien pour partager des photos - Guide
- Changer la couleur de la barre des taches - Guide
- Verificateur de lien - Guide
4 réponses
rajoute dans ton fichier css ces différentes lignes
Modifie la couleur par celle que tu veux.
"a" c'est l'apparence d'un lien normal.
"a:visited" c'est l'apparence d'un lien après avoir cliqué dessus.
"a:hover" c'est l'apparence d'un lien lorsque ta souris passe dessus.
J'espère que j'ai répondu à ta question.
a {border:0; color:#FFFFFF}
a:visited {border:0; color:#FFFFFF}
a:hover {border:0}; color:#FFFFFF
Modifie la couleur par celle que tu veux.
"a" c'est l'apparence d'un lien normal.
"a:visited" c'est l'apparence d'un lien après avoir cliqué dessus.
"a:hover" c'est l'apparence d'un lien lorsque ta souris passe dessus.
J'espère que j'ai répondu à ta question.
Oui tu as parfaitement répondu à ma question, ... mais pour le mode CSS. Hors mon site je le fais en html. Donc dans le mode html cela donne quoi au juste ?
A propos ces balises doivent être mises dans <head></head> ou dans <body></body> ? Bonne soirée
A propos ces balises doivent être mises dans <head></head> ou dans <body></body> ? Bonne soirée
Si tu met ton CSS directement dans ta page HTML, tu as 2 solutions (enfin plutot une solution car l'autre n'est pas vraiment une bonne façon de procéder)
La 1er (et la meilleur) c'est de mettre ton code CSS entre les balise <style></style> qui se trouve entre les balise <head></head> :)
la 2ème solution c'est de mettre a chaque balise html son code CSS
par exemple a un balise de titre :
<h1 style="code CSS">Titre 1</h1>
Cette technique fonctionne mais c'est vraiment déconseiller car si tu veux modifier le titre 1 (en gardant mon exemple) tu devra le modifier partout.
Cepandant, si tu as entre les balises <style></style> du code CSS pour <h1> et que dans ton code HTML, tu a une contradiction par exemple
ton code CSS du body est plus important que celui du head donc ici, ton titre aura un fond blanc et pas noir.
bref, revenons a ton problème :p
tu met donc ton code entre les balises <style></style>
ce qui donne
La 1er (et la meilleur) c'est de mettre ton code CSS entre les balise <style></style> qui se trouve entre les balise <head></head> :)
la 2ème solution c'est de mettre a chaque balise html son code CSS
par exemple a un balise de titre :
<h1 style="code CSS">Titre 1</h1>
Cette technique fonctionne mais c'est vraiment déconseiller car si tu veux modifier le titre 1 (en gardant mon exemple) tu devra le modifier partout.
Cepandant, si tu as entre les balises <style></style> du code CSS pour <h1> et que dans ton code HTML, tu a une contradiction par exemple
<head>
<style>
h1 {background-colo: #000000;}
</style>
</head>
<body>
<h1 style="background-color: #FFFFFF;">Titre 1</h1>
</body>
ton code CSS du body est plus important que celui du head donc ici, ton titre aura un fond blanc et pas noir.
bref, revenons a ton problème :p
tu met donc ton code entre les balises <style></style>
ce qui donne
<style>
a {border:0; color:#FFFFFF}
a:visited {border:0; color:#FFFFFF}
a:hover {border:0; color:#FFFFFF}
</style>